def solve(N, K): SN = str(N) NN = len(SN) SK = str(K) NK = len(SK) cnt = 0 for i in range(NN): start = 10 ** i if NK > i: end = int(SK[:i + 1]) if end > K: end = K else: end = K * 10 ** (i - NK + 1) - 1 if end > N: end = N cnt += end - start + 1 # print(i,start,end,cnt) return cnt T = int(input()) for t in range(T): N, K = map(int, input().split()) print(solve(N, K))